(MRC Keneba Field Station)
The Keneba field station
has carried out nutritional research in Keneba village and the surrounding
village for over 50 years the Permanent research station and clinic provides
antenatal, mother-day-baby clinics, dietary supplementation and general medical
clinics. There are a team of local and international scientist and research
clinicians all engaged in their own research projects, and a team of medical
doctors midwives, nurses, laboratory technicians, field workers, data-entry
clerks and administrative staff, all supporting the keneba research programme
and clinic facility. Data from the clinics, research projects biobank and
demographic surveillance systems are all maintained in single integrated database
system.
The keneba Field
Station is seeking to appoint a Senior Scientific Officer to conduct and manage
research activities in the Calcium, Vitamin D and Bone Health (CDBH) group. The
CDBH group conduct studies across the life course and aims to identify the role
of diet and lifestyle in bone health and the prevention of osteoporosis and
rickets. The post-holder will contribute directly to the research and strategy
of the group. The focus of research will be determined by the experience of the
successful applicant and is likely to include studies of local people that
require physiological measures, laboratory assays and data analysis. She/he is
also responsible for aspects of the management, co-ordination and smooth-running
of the work of CDBH at MRC keneba.
